Dr. Moh Abuarchid
FRACGP, MRCGP, MD
Dr. Moh is a vocationally registered General Practitioner. After completing his medical training, he commenced further training at King’s College, London and Lutheran Medical Centre in New York. He returned to the UK and completed his GP training in Cardiff, Wales after which he became a GP Partner, a GP Trainer and the lead GP for a busy Out-of Hours Service covering Bristol and the South West Region of the UK. He relocated to Perth in 2015 and with over 15 years experience as a General Practitioner, he is well versed in all aspects of family medicine, mental health, men’s health, paediatric health and chronic disease management. He has a keen interest in diabetes management and weight loss management. He also has a special interest in all aspects of dermatology & skin lesions, performing many minor surgical procedures and skin cancer excisions on a weekly basis.
Dr. Christopher Boynton
FRACGP, MBBS
Dr. Chris is a vocationally registered General Practitioner originally from East Yorkshire in the UK. He had a variety of careers before becoming a doctor which included aged care, working with physically and mentally disabled adults and children. This work included adults and children with autism and is where he developed a keen interest in this area. He also spent five years serving as a Police Officer in both the Humberside and Metropolitan Police Forces before going to university to follow his life long dream of becoming a doctor. He completed his medical and surgical training at the University of Nottingham in the UK where he also completed a Bachelor of Medical Science. He then went on to work in a wide variety of medical and surgical specialties in both England and Scotland before returning to his native Yorkshire to complete his GP training. He then worked in East Yorkshire as a Locum GP before moving across to WA where numerous members of his family already live and where he has dreamed of living since spending time in Australia in 2010. He enjoys all aspects of general practice including mental health, men and women’s health, chronic disease management and pediatrics. He also has a very keen interest in skin lesions, cryotherapy and surgical procedures.

Dr. Andy Carr
FRACGP, MRCGP, MbBCh
Dr Andy Carr is a Fellow of the Royal Australian College of General Practitioners (FRACGP). He graduated from Cardiff University Medical School in 2007 and completed numerous placements after graduation, including gastroenterology, colorectal surgery, paediatrics, ear nose and throat, respiratory medicine, and emergency medicine.
In 2009 he pursued 2 further years of in hospital general medicine training, including cardiology, and further respiratory and care of the elderly placements, before commencing a 3 year general practice vocational programme in 2011. This included placements in acute medicine, emergency medicine, rheumatology and dermatology as well as GP registrar placements. He completed vocational GP training in 2014 being awarded MRCGP.
He also performs minor procedures such as toenail wedge resection for ingrowing toenails, excisions, as well is insertion and removal of implanons.
Dr. Richard Hilditch
FRACGP, MRCGP, MBChB, MRCS
Dr Hilditch graduated from Sheffield University UK in 1998. He obtained membership of the Royal College of Surgeons in 2002 and then membership of the Royal College of General Practitioners in 2005. He then worked as a full time partner in general practice in Sheffield, UK before emigrating to Australia in 2016, where he was granted fellowship of the Royal College of Australian General Practitioners.
He is happy to see all aspects of general practice and his special interests include skin checks and skin cancer surgery, dermatology, men’s health, urology and minor surgery.
Outside of work he spends his time with his wife, two children, and two Labradors Ivy and Stanley.
Dr Hilditch also enjoys playing in a local 9 piece soul band.
